Abstract:
For routing a data packet in a wireless network in a reliable, yet simple way, thus improving network scalability and communication efficiency, a routing unit, a system and a method for routing a data packet in a wireless network are provided, wherein overlay routing is performed between junction groups comprising at least one node using a position- based routing protocol and underlay routing is performed between nodes of the network using link-based routing.
Abstract:
For improving data packet transmission from a collector node to one or more network nodes without additional routing protocols or increase of the overall network load, a system and a method are provided, wherein a node and/or the collector node receiving an uplink data packet addressed to the collector node is adapted to store at least a sender node information and a transmitting node information as a reverse-route information for a predetermined time.
Abstract:
For load balancing in a large-scale wireless mesh network, a device, a system and a method are provided for controlling data packet transmissions in the wireless mesh network, wherein a time slot is randomly selected within a determined answer interval for transmitting an answer responding to a received data packet.
Abstract:
The invention relates to networks having at least one slave terminal or device, and a master terminal or device connected thereto that controls the network and is arranged to instruct at least one slave terminal or device to exchange sub-network information with at least one other sub-network. On receipt of an inquiry, a slave terminal or device in another sub-networks transmits a response to the inquiring slave terminal or device in the first sub-network. The communicating slave terminals or devices pass on the sub-network information that is exchanged to the master terminal or device, for the responding sub-network to be merged into the inquiring sub network.

Abstract:
For improving application data traffic in a communications network, data traffic of at least one application of the communications network is divided into two types in view of the current situation of the network – a first type comprising data, which can be transmitted by delaying the transmission, and a second type comprising data, which should not be delayed but should be transmitted at the current time. When an analysis of the current (average) load of the network shows that transmitting both types of data could lead to a heavy data traffic, a temporal transmission suppression session can be performed with regard to at least one entity of the communications network. In the temporal transmission suppression session, transmitting of data of the first type is interrupted during transmitting data of the second type. After completion of transmitting data of the second type, transmitting data of the first type is resumed.
Abstract:
For improving handling of alarm message storms in a communications network, alarm message storm avoidance, detection and/or recovery are implemented at nodes (23) and/or at data traffic controlling nodes (3, 20, 22) of the communications network. For alarm message storm avoidance, a random time spreading of alarm message transmissions is proposed, wherein the random time spreading of alarm message transmissions can be based on the current context and/or node state. For alarm message storm detection, it is proposed to monitor the alarm message inflow frequency to trigger a recovery process, wherein the monitoring can be performed with regard to different alarm types, parts of the network and/or time periods locally and/or centrally. The alarm message storm recovery or processing, respectively, is implemented by suppressing the amount of alarm messages to be transmitted. The alarm message storm recovery or processing can be implemented in a centralized and/or in a distributed way.
Abstract:
For reducing an end-to-end delay of data packet transmissions in a large-scale wireless mesh network, a device, a system and a method are provided for controlling data packet transmissions in the wireless network, wherein an answertime-out of a sender node is adjusted based on a distance between the sender node and a destination node.
Abstract:
In order to increase multi-hop transmission reliability in a large-scale wireless mesh network, a device, a system and a method are provided for controlling data packet transmissions in the wireless mesh network, wherein a retry of a data packet transmission is delayed, when it is determined that a transmission medium is busy after a predetermined maximum number of carrier sensing attempts and/or that the transmission remains unacknowledged after a predetermined maximum number of acknowledgement attempts.
Abstract:
A searching apparatus is put into the position of identifying the available apparatuses and services in its proximity in that an apparatus to be discovered periodically separates itself from its Access Point and builds up its own Ad hoc Network (AHN) which can be recognized via its Service Set Identifier (SSID) by the searching apparatus.
